Output 20e009690e0cdc8418818b71b20e83f8a74503b0ddaabcc6d7296c4ec75eb8cd:8

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cf8c73e14430f43672e54bd73136a8c11b9724e OP_EQUAL
address
MDTYoMkwTqUCLVCtJ7DepfatCi77LN3CwM
transaction
20e009690e0cdc8418818b71b20e83f8a74503b0ddaabcc6d7296c4ec75eb8cd
spent
true